1989 to 1991 - ARC Research Fellow, Dept. of Civil Engineering, The University of Newcastle, New South Wales, Australia

Finite element analysis of soil-structure interaction problems. Emphasis was placed on the analysis of buried flexible tubes and culverts under large deformations up to and beyond buckling. Development of theoretical aspects and the computer programs for the above analyses. Part-time lecturing and conducting lab classes for undergraduate students in Geotechnical Engineering.

1985 to 1989 - PhD Research Scholar, Part-Time Tutor/Research Assistant, Dept. of Civil Engineering, Monash University, Melbourne, Australia

Research on the shear behaviour of rock-concrete joints and side resistance of piles in weak rock. This project included experimentation of rock-concrete joints in a specially designed large direct shear machine under various stress paths, modification of the above machine to perform specific tasks, development of a computer model for the simulation of the rock-concrete joint behaviour and the rock-socketed pile performance, conducting parametric studies and development of a design methodology for piles socketed into Melbourne mudstone. Computer Software Development and Involvement (1985 onwards)

  • JOINTR - An irregular triangular joint model for the simulation of shearing of a rock-concrete joint, Monash University.
  • AFENA - AFENA (A Finite Element Algorithm) is developed by Sydney University (Professor J. Carter). I added the nonlinear structural elements for buried tube modelling and a new interaction analysis utilising sub-structure techniques for large deformations and arc-length control solution methods for solving problems featuring bifurcating or turning load paths, Newcastle, University.
  • BOREFLO - To plot fence diagram of borehole data and air-lifted flow rates with depth using Lahey Fortran and Hgraph plotting routines, Golder Associates.
  • WCAP - A user friendly water chemistry analysis and plotting using Lahey Fortran, Spindrift Windows and Hgraph plotting routines, Golder Associates.
  • FPIG - A user friendly menu-driven front end program for DEFPIG pile analysis program (Professor Harry Poulos, Sydney University) using Lahey Fortran and Spindrift Windows library, Golder Associates.
  • GGWP - The development and enhancement of certain sections of Golder groundwater finite element program (GGWP). These included the development of a bandwidth minimiser to reduce computer time substantially for large problems. Implementation of non-linear optimisation schemes to provide an automatic error analysis feature to assist large model calibration, Golder Associates.
  • GWEDGEM - This is a state-of-the-art slope stability program using generalised wedge method developed by Professor I.B. Donald and the late Dr Peter Giam. at Monash University. I made certain improvements and developed a simple graphical interface for this program, Golder Associates.
  • SETTLE - A user-friendly menu-driven program for stress and settlement analysis due to general loading conditions including rectangular and circular loading areas. The program features deterministic and probabilistic computation of elastic, consolidation and creep settlements. Developed using Lahey Fortran and Interactor graphics software, Golder Associates.
  • Several custom programs for unsaturated flow modelling, flux boundary modelling and contaminant leachate modelling and clay cracking.
